  • Particular Divine Attributes

    Spiritual traditions ascribe particular attributes to the divine, mirrored within the names used to deal with or describe them. For example, in Christianity, the identify “God the Father” emphasizes the paternal and creator elements of the divine. In Hinduism, the identify “Vishnu the Preserver” highlights the deity’s function in sustaining cosmic order. Understanding these attributes inside their respective traditions is important for decoding the names and their significance.

  • Ritual Practices and Prayers

    Divine names play a central function in ritual practices and prayers inside spiritual traditions. Particular names could also be invoked throughout ceremonies, chants, or private prayers, connecting practitioners with the divine in particular methods. For instance, the repetition of the identify “Allah” in Islamic prayer fosters a way of reference to the divine. Equally, the chanting of mantras containing divine names in Hinduism is believed to invoke particular blessings or energies. Inspecting the utilization of names inside ritual contexts reveals their sensible perform inside spiritual follow.

  • Sacred Texts and Scriptures

    Divine names usually seem prominently in sacred texts and scriptures, offering insights into the theological ideas and narratives central to a selected custom. For example, the Hebrew Bible explores numerous names for God, every revealing completely different aspects of the divine nature. The Quran emphasizes the 99 names of Allah, providing a framework for understanding divine attributes. Analyzing the utilization of names inside sacred texts gives worthwhile insights into the theological underpinnings of a convention.

8. Etymological Evaluation

Etymological evaluation performs a vital function in understanding the deeper which means and significance of divine names inside a “names of god guide.” By exploring the linguistic roots and historic growth of those names, one positive factors worthwhile insights into the evolution of non secular thought, cultural influences, and the nuanced methods completely different cultures understand the divine. This evaluation gives a basis for a extra complete understanding of the names and their affect on spiritual traditions.

  • Uncovering Authentic Meanings

    Tracing the linguistic origins of divine names reveals their authentic meanings and the way these meanings have developed over time. For instance, analyzing the Hebrew identify “El Shaddai” reveals its attainable connection to the phrase “shad” (breast), suggesting nourishment and provision. Understanding these authentic meanings gives a deeper appreciation for the attributes and roles related to the divine.

  • Tracing Cultural Influences

    Etymological evaluation can uncover cultural influences on the event of divine names. Borrowed phrases and tailored meanings reveal interactions between completely different cultures and their affect on spiritual language. For example, the identify “Allah” in Islam shares roots with the Aramaic phrase “Alaha,” demonstrating linguistic connections and potential cross-cultural influences within the growth of non secular terminology.

  • Illuminating Conceptual Shifts

    Inspecting the evolution of divine names by etymological evaluation illuminates shifts in theological ideas and spiritual understanding over time. Modifications in which means and utilization can mirror evolving beliefs and altering cultural values. For instance, the shift in utilization from the Hebrew identify “Elohim” to “Yahweh” within the Previous Testomony could mirror a creating understanding of the divine nature and the connection between God and humanity.
